JEE Main 2022:

The National Testing Agency (NTA) on Wednesday has revised the dates of Joint Entrance Examination (Main) 2022 Session 1 and Session 2 considering the multiple requests from the students who have registered to appear in the exam. 

As per the revised dates, the JEE Main 2022 Session will be held on 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, and 29 June 2022 while the session 2 exams will be held on 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29 and 30 July 2022

The Registration for Session 1 is over now. The schedule for inviting the online Application Forms for Session 2 of JEE (Main) 2022 will be available soon, informed the NTA in an official notification. 

Earlier, the students have been urging the NTA as well as Ministry of Education to modify the exam dates. They were asking for bringing a brief gap between the two sessions to prepare well. 

In the latest, the NTA has started an application correction window for the registered candidates on the official website at jeemain.nta.nic.in 

Those who have made mistakes while submitting the application form at first place, can go to the official website to rectify their mistake. Candidates should keep in mind that the board will not consider requests for another chance after this. Therefore, they are required to make change carefully. 

JEE Main 2022 application correction window will continue to open till April 8 up to 9 P.M. 

The decision of conducting the application correction round comes after the NTA received multiple requests from the candidates for sparing them a chance to modify their forms. 

All the registered candidates for the said Examination are advised to visit the website and verify their particulars.
